What are high quality candles made of?
There are many kinds of waxes that are used for scented candles. These include palm, gel and bayberry wax, but the three most used waxes, in which 94% of the candle market are made from, are paraffin (69%), soy (22%) and beeswax (2%). Each wax holds its own natural fragrance, melting point and price level.

Why should you not burn a candle for more than 4 hours?
If you burn your candle for more than 4 hours at a time, carbon will collect on the wick, and your wick will begin to “mushroom.” This can cause the wick to become unstable, the flame to get too large, your candle to smoke, and soot to be released into the air and around your candle container.

How can I make my candles smell stronger?
- Use the recommended percentage of fragrance oil for the type of wax you’re using. …
- Be sure to weigh your fragrance oils on a scale, not measure in a cup or spoon.
- Add fragrance oil at 185Fº and stir gently and thoroughly with the melted wax.
Which soy wax holds the most scent?
- AAK Golden Brands 464. Our favorite wax and longtime best seller. We use 464 for all of our fragrance testing because we found it produces the strongest scent while burning.
- AAK Golden Brands 444. Very similar to 464, but with a slightly higher melt point.
